Police, Army Recover 21 Bodies of Vigilantes Killed by Bandits in Niger

No fewer than 21 members of a vigilante group in Niger State popularly referred to as Yan Sakai by the locals, were gruesomely murdered by armed bandits in an ambush, it was learnt on Thursday.

Sources hinted Scudnews that the incident occurred on Tuesday at Danko village along Kotonkoro-Dutsen Magaji road in Mariga Local Government Area of the state.

A joint security patrol team comprising the police and soldiers recovered 21 bodies of the slain vigilante men on Wednesday, with six of the corpses said to have already decomposed.

The state police command said several of the vigilante men were still being held captive by the bandits in their den, but it had yet to ascertain the number of hostages.

Scudnews further learnt that the charred remains of about 20 motorcycles suspected to belong to the murdered local security men littered the scene.

Police said efforts were ongoing to rescue those held captive.
